JKBOSE Announces Revised Schedule for Annual Regular Examinations 2024: Ensuring Smooth Conduct Amidst Changing Circumstances

In a recent announcement, the Jammu and Kashmir Board of School Education (JKBOSE) has disclosed an updated schedule for the Annual Regular Examinations 2023-24, targeting Classes X, XI, and XII in the Hard Zone areas. This adjustment comes with significant changes, including modifications in examination timings and the introduction of dual shifts for certain classes, aimed at streamlining the examination process and accommodating various stakeholders’ needs effectively.

The 10th Annual Regular examinations for Hard Zone areas are scheduled to commence from April 4, 2024, at 10:00 am in the morning shift, marking a crucial milestone for students in these regions. Similarly, the 12th class examinations for the same zone are set to begin from April 8, 2024, at 2:00 pm in the evening shift, providing students with ample preparation time to perform at their best.

In a bid to ensure equitable treatment, adjustments have been made for the 11th class examinations in Soft Zone areas, which will now begin from April 2, 2024, at 1:00 pm. Meanwhile, the 11th class examinations for Hard Zone areas are rescheduled to commence from April 22, 2024, at 10:00 am, aligning with the board’s commitment to fairness and accessibility in education.

The decision to revise the examination schedule was prompted by various factors, including directives from the Joint Chief Electoral Officer, UT of J&K, Jammu, regarding the Lok Sabha Election 2024 schedule, and communication from the National Testing Agency regarding the Joint Entrance Examination (Main) 2024. Additionally, the board considered numerous representations from students advocating for the rescheduling of JKBOSE exams, demonstrating a commitment to responsiveness and student-centric decision-making.
